And not only are they lovely to look at, but they also are good to eat.   Several family members were here for a recent meal, and we all enjoyed eating the blooms on a large salad.

If you’ve never eaten nasturtium blooms before, you may be surprised.  They taste much like radishes and make a wonderful addition to a salad. My neighbor and I also ate some straight from her garden. Thank you, Alisa, for the edible flowers!
